They can easily get information such as IP address (and your city and ISP from that), browser (including version), operating system, whether Javascript, Flash, etc. are installed/enabled, the referring website, how many (and perhaps which) websites you've viewed in that window, your monitor resolution, etc. Only your IP address is passed along when you send an e-mail, but websites can check such information when you visit.
